Garland is a town located in Sampson County, North Carolina. Garland has a 2026 population of 622. Garland is currently growing at a rate of 0.65% annually and its population has increased by 4.01% since the most recent census, which recorded a population of 598 in 2020.

The median household income in Garland is $57,829 with a poverty rate of 9.09%. The median age in Garland is 24.7 years: 23.7 years for males, and 39.6 years for females. For every 100 females there are 74.7 males.
